About Yi Qu
Yi Qu is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Oncology,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Surgery and Molecular Biology, having authored 13 papers that have together received 402 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cancer Treatment and Pharmacology (2 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(2 papers), Cardiomyopathy and Myosin Studies (2 papers), Traditional Chinese Medicine Analysis (2 papers), Nanoplatforms for cancer theranostics (1 paper), Healthcare and Venom Research (1 paper), Natural Antidiabetic Agents Studies (1 paper) and Neuropeptides and Animal Physiology (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Complementary and alternative medicine (52 citations), Pathology and Forensic Medicine (79 citations), Biochemistry (24 citations), Pharmacology (65 citations) and Pharmacology (32 citations). Yi Qu has collaborated with scholars based in China, Taiwan and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Chang Shang, Hongchen Lin, Yingdong Lu, Xiangning Cui, Jialiang Gao, Laiyun Xin, Yuling Wang, Zhilin Jiang, Zihuan Shen and Mi Xiang. Their work appears in journals such as Evidence-based Complementary and Alternative Medicine, BMB Reports, Food & Function, Bioorganic & Medicinal Chemistry Letters and Frontiers in Pharmacology.
